However, “that guy” who rolls in wearing the latest in sweatpants/sweatshirt fashion, which double as pajamas and a napkin, will likely be laughed at and not taken seriously. A professional appearance – from a clean and pressed (wrinkle free) polo shirt with clean and pressed jeans or slacks, to a full suit and tie – demonstrates professionalism and commands respect, at least on first contact. While not only representing himself as a human being and a professional (term used loosely here for “that guy”), he is also representing his client, the legal professions field and, ultimately, the entire court and justice system. “That guy” and his mindset couldn’t be further from the ideal of our profession. His thought process is, “Who cares what I look like, so long as I get the job done?” We’ve all seen “that guy” who could care less what he looks like when he is working as a private investigator or process server.
